Subject: Handover — Tilehound prefetcher

Hi Marisol,

Handing over the Tilehound map-tile prefetcher before your review. Overnight, the prefetch queue backed up twice; both times the cause was the zoom-level-14 batch exceeding the per-region fetch budget. I've capped batch size at 200 tiles in my patch — please scrutinize the retry logic around line-of-sight tiles, since I'm least confident there. Metrics dashboards are linked in the PR description. If anything looks off during review, reach me at the address below.

— Tobin

alerts address for kajog-tadup: druox@plorvanet.internal

Subject: Quorra Launch Plan — Executive Briefing

Team, ahead of Director Hale's arrival, here is the launch framework for the Quorra analytics suite. Phase one covers a limited pilot with twelve accounts; phase two expands to the Ostbridge region in spring. Pricing, enablement, and support readiness are tracked weekly. All risks are logged and owned. Please review the appendix before the onboarding session, and note the confidential item below.

internal memo for kawip-hadug: Headcount on the Wenwyn team goes from 7 to 140 by the end of January. Gross margin on Wenwyn came in at 20 percent against a plan of 15 percent.

Subject: Handover — Telemetry Gateway Duties

Team, effective next sprint I'm stepping back from the Furrowline telemetry gateway that relays sensor data from Harrow & Dell tractors. Deploy scripts, alert runbooks, and the firmware compatibility matrix are all in the usual repo. For future maintainers, escalations and release approvals now go to the new owner, named below.

account owner for bawip-tahag: Raleth Quenok

## 3.2.0 — Baseline setting renamed

Heads up: the old `LINTHAVEN_BASELINE_PATH` setting is gone. We renamed it to `LINTHAVEN_BASELINE_FILE` so it matches the CLI flag, and the static-analysis baseline now lives under `quality/baseline.json` instead of the repo root. Old name still works this release but logs a deprecation warning, so please nudge teams before 3.3.0 drops it for good. One more migration chore: the analyzer's upload credential needs to be added to the env file directly after this line.

env line for fafof-fahag: LEDGER_TOKEN5=f8790